Brick Police launch an investigation into a late afternoon bank robbery. Township Police say they were notified by an alarm company that a robbery was in progress at the Ocean First Bank Branch on Adamston Road at around 3:45 p.m. Friday.

Police say the suspect entered the bank and handed the teller a note demanding money and indicating that he had a gun but no weapons were shown. The suspect fled with money and entered a green vehicle that witnesses believe was possibly a Mazda.

The suspect is described as a white male, approximately 6 foot tall, weighing 180 lbs, wearing a black baseball cap, dark hood coat, a light grey shirt, blue jeans and dark sneakers.

The robbery is being investigated by Detectives Eric Olsen and Thomas Cooney from the Brick Township Police Department Investigations Unit along with the Federal Bureau of Investigations, Red Bank Office.
